Kip Stephen Thorne (born June 1, 1940) is an American theoretical physicist known for his contributions in gravitational physics and astrophysics. A longtime friend and colleague of Stephen Hawking and Carl Sagan, he was the Richard P. Feynman Professor of Theoretical Physics at the California Institute of Technology (Caltech) until 2009 and is one of the world's leading experts on the astrophysical implications of Einstein's general theory of relativity. Thorne's parents were members of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(LDS Church) and raised Thorne in the LDS faith, though he now describes himself as atheist. Nobel Prize in Physics (2017) (jointly with Rainer Weiss and Barry Barish)

Interestingly named after James E Talmage. Also his father Randy Bachman from BTO. Tal went on splits with us back when he was still in and I served in his ward as a missionary. He was such a likeable guy.
Tal shows up in Bill Maher’s doc Religulous, talking about TSCC, I remember reading an article in a weekly where Tal had just resigned from TSCC, and he apologized to the interviewer about how strange he still felt about ordering a beer,. He also explained the reason for leaving - he was called as a Sunday School teacher, and he decided to do research on Ol’ Joe, and of course he went down the rabbit hole. When his leaders gave him the Ol’ “ we don’t know, and the answers will come when we’re all dead” runaround, that’s when he resigned, along with his wife and six kids. He had some choice words about his Mom , who was ultra TBM and very fanatical. Two weeks after the article, Tal was on a CBC program with Randy, and his dad made it clear that he loved and supported his son. They’re both quite close to this day, and are currently working on an album together. Randy is also out now.
